- Summary:
- Alice Monroe was a 30-year-old married mother of two who was an admissions officer at the Kellogg School of Management at Northwestern University. She was just completing her first year of service at Northwestern and qualified for the university's 403(b) retirement plan. It was early October 2017 and she had until the end of the month to decide if, to what extent, and how she would participate in Northwestern's retirement plan--that is, how much of her salary would she put into the retirement plan, and into which mutual fund or funds would she allocate her savings?
